The Pole d'expression theatrale (PET) was created in September 2009 to organize theatrical activities and events on the UNIL and EPFL campuses. It encompasses various theatrical domains such as traditional theater, cafe-theater, and improvisation, including matches, shows, and international festivals. Throughout the year, PET presents three to four theater pieces, two improvisation festivals, workshops, and other activities, attracting around 3000 spectators annually. PET is committed to combating harassment and discrimination, providing support structures for addressing abusive behaviors and promoting a safe environment on the UNIL-EPFL campuses.
